ALERT: quorvia-api latency regression. Root cause was an N+1 pattern in the GraphQL resolver for order line items — fixed in the Tallowfield release by batching via the loader layer. If this alert fires again, check for new resolvers bypassing the loader. Triage steps and the resolver checklist are on the internal page below.

wiki page, tahaf-tajog: https://jira.ordindyn.corp/pipeline

Subject: Quickstore 4.2 — bloom filter now fronts the KV layer

Plugin authors: starting with this release, Quickstore places a bloom filter ahead of the key-value store. Negative lookups return faster; false positives fall through safely. No API changes are required on your side. Verify your plugin against the staging build referenced below.

session token of fahif-tadup = htk3_9c7

Subject: Inkwell markdown pipeline 5.1 deployed

On-call: the Inkwell rendering pipeline is now on 5.1 in production. Changes: sanitizer runs before the table parser, footnote rendering is cached per document, and the fallback plain-text path no longer strips headings. If render latency alarms fire, roll back via the standard script — it handles cache invalidation. Known issue: nested blockquotes over six levels render flat. The deployment trace token follows.

build token for hawep-kageg: htk14_558814e2114cc7

Hi Marta — before I head off, a note on the basement archive room at Thistlegate House. It holds the Rowanfield contract files; please keep the dehumidifier running and log every file you remove in the red ledger by the door. The keypad is on the left. The entry code is below.

door code, yagap-bahof: bdg-O-05

## Runbook: Inventory Reconciliation Job (Ortolan)

Runs nightly at 02:15. Compares warehouse counts in Stockmere against ledger entries in Tallyvane. Drift over 0.3% pages on-call; under that, a diff report lands in the ops folder.

If the job stalls: check the Stockmere export lock first, then restart the worker pool — never rerun mid-cycle, it double-counts transfers. Manual reconciliation requires sign-off from the inventory lead. For this week's sync, confirm last night's run completed clean under the token below.

pipeline stamp: htk9_6ce9d33c5